Where is ibis budget Marne la Vallée Pontault Combault located?
ibis budget Marne la Vallée Pontault Combault, Île-de-France, France (approx. 48.79918°, 2.62574°)
ibis budget Marne la Vallée Pontault Combault, Île-de-France, France (approx. 48.79918°, 2.62574°)